Breaking Down Smart Garage Door Technology Costs

Smart garage door systems aren't one flat price. They're built in layers, and understanding those layers helps you budget accurately.

The smart opener itself (the device that connects to wifi and your smartphone app) typically costs $150 to $400 retail. Installation labor adds another $150 to $300. If you're upgrading from an older, non-smart opener, you may also need a new garage door opener unit entirely, which pushes the total closer to $800 to $1,200. Some homeowners already have a compatible opener and only need the smart controller added, which is the cheapest route.

Additional sensors for door position, motion detection, and battery backup can add $100 to $300 more. Home automation integration (connecting your system to Alexa, Google Home, or Apple HomeKit) is sometimes built in, but advanced setups cost extra.

What Affects Your Final Cost Estimate

Several factors change the number you'll see on an estimate.

Your current garage door opener age and condition matter significantly. If springs are worn or the motor is failing, you're better off replacing the whole unit rather than adding smart tech to a dying machine. (We cover that decision in detail in our guide to garage door openers in South Pasadena.) A newer opener from the last five years may already have smart-compatible wiring, lowering your cost.

Wifi coverage in your garage affects cost too. If your router signal is weak, you might need a wifi extender (another $30 to $80). Some homeowners in South Pasadena and nearby areas like San Diego find they need professional wifi setup as part of the installation.

Your choice of brand and features changes price. Basic systems let you open and close remotely via app. Premium systems add scheduling, real-time alerts, activity logs, and guest access codes. Those extras cost $200 to $400 more but are worth it if you want full home automation control.

Is Smart Technology Worth the Investment?

Cost is only half the question. Real value comes from convenience, security, and peace of mind.

If you travel for work or have family members who forget keys, remote access via app alone justifies the spend. You eliminate the "Did I close the garage?" worry and can grant temporary access to contractors or guests without handing over clickers. Many South Pasadena homeowners tell us the app feature saves them a trip home on stressful days.

Security alerts matter too. Modern systems notify you instantly if your garage opens outside normal hours. That's genuine protection against theft or unwanted access. Home automation integration lets your garage door coordinate with lighting, locks, and alarm systems, creating a seamless security ecosystem.

The cost to add smart tech to an existing reliable opener is often $300 to $500, which most homeowners recoup in reduced stress and avoided lockouts within a year or two. If you need a full opener replacement anyway, the smart upgrade adds maybe 30 percent to your total bill but doubles your system's capability.

Common Questions About Smart System Pricing

Labor costs vary by complexity. A retrofit on an existing opener takes 1 to 2 hours and costs less than a full replacement, which takes 2 to 3 hours. Same-day installation is available for most South Pasadena properties.

If your door is stuck or won't open, you might need repair work before adding smart tech. A broken spring or failed motor should be fixed first; adding smart features to a broken door wastes money.

Long term, smart systems have no hidden costs beyond the initial installation. There's no monthly subscription for basic app and wifi features, though some premium monitoring services (like professional security integration) do charge monthly.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a basic smart garage door opener cost? A basic smart opener retrofit costs $300 to $600 installed. This adds wifi and app control to your existing door. Full system replacement with a new smart opener runs $800 to $1,200 depending on your setup.

Can I add smart technology to my old garage door opener? Yes, if your opener is less than 10 years old and mechanically sound. We can retrofit a smart controller for $300 to $400. Older or failing openers should be replaced entirely for safety and reliability.

Do smart garage door systems have monthly fees? No. Basic app and wifi control are free after installation. Optional premium features like professional monitoring or advanced home automation integration may have small monthly costs, but they're not required.

How long does installation take? Retrofit installations typically take 1 to 2 hours. Full opener replacement takes 2 to 3 hours. We offer same-day service for most South Pasadena locations.

What if my wifi is weak in the garage? We can install a wifi extender ($30 to $80) or position the smart hub for better signal. Poor wifi is rare in South Pasadena, but we address it during the estimate if needed.
